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
31 14933733693 7748668335
066939681 72429995428 3528105
066939681 72429995428 3528105
91 05351 8842
All about undefined
Interested in learning more?
066939681 72429995428 3528105
91 05351 8842
See more
08082 10562650 592943100
862516894 15171578 7185915 330
See more
703 2090 490
14052785080 567 1724061
See more